biographical info

Not hibernating after all

 

Montag is back after what could seem like a long absence. But in fact there’s not been one minute of silence for Antoine Bédard since his 2007 Carpark release, Going Places. There were in fact a few self-released mini-albums, including Hibernation (2008) coinciding with his return to cold Montréal and Des cassettes et un walkman jaune (2009) a covers EP, not to mention a dozen remixes for the likes of M83, Au Revoir Simone, I'm From Barcelona and Stars. But it was his work as a sound designer that took most of his time: in the last five years, he wrote the scores to twenty theatre works presented throughout Canada, as well as the original music for five contemporary dance pieces. Alongside this, Antoine created sound designs for twenty theatre works presented throughout Canada, wrote the music for five contemporary dance pieces, narrated and edited two audioguides and curated two soundwalks about the relationship between music and architecture. In 2008, Bédard also co-founded, with two of his friends, an immensely succesful bi-monthly electropop club night in Montréal called Mec Plus Ultra, hosting guest live bands like Miami Horror and Diamond Rings and The XX and Two Door Cinema Club doing exclusive DJ sets. Not just the host, Montag was one of the resident DJs of the night, allowing him to share his favorite pop gems, including some tunes by current labelmates like Class Actress and Toro y Moi.

 

 

Phases

 

After four years of making music on a variety of different projects, it is time for Bédard to get back to his own creation. But making an album seems too restrictive, so Antoine comes up with Phases, opting for a singularly different approach: releasing one single a month over the course of the whole year, with each song creating its own sonic world, meant to be enjoyed one at a time. To add to the challenge, Montag will assign himself style restrictions to every month, keeping each single distinct and allowing him to explore new musical territory in the process.

 

Phases will have Montag following a few basic rules: each single must be created within a month and be accompanied by a b-side (either an original song, a cover or a remix) and a video. He will blog about the creative process in detail on his website, with extra information on how the tracks were recorded, their origins, the type of instruments used, etc. Each single will also have its own cover designed by Guadaljara-based graphic artist Curious Flux. As Going Places proved, Bédard enjoys collaborations and Phases should be no exception: most singles will be recorded with the help of special guests. Each release will be accompanied by an audio documentary produced and narrated by Montag, explaining how the songs were written and produced.
